露天矿外排土场排弃高度对复合边坡稳定性影响的研究
Study on effect of dumping height of external dump on composite slopes stability in open-pit mine

In order to study the impact of dump height on the bearing capacity of the foundation and the slope stability of the external dump,this article analyzes the dump height of No.1 Open-pit Coal Mine in Xinjiang Jianghai Gobi,establishes the composite slope with different dump heights using FLAC3D software for stability analysis.The results show that as the dump height increases,there is a significant vertical displacement and displacement in the direction of the slope surface,with a tendency for shear strain to concentrate on the slope.The stability coefficient gradually decreases.When the dump height reaches 160 m,the influence of external dump on the slope becomes small,and the slope stability coefficient is 1.56,which is higher than the design requirement.The stacking height of the dump can be increased to 160 m.关键词
